Opus One is a software engineering company that brings real-time energy management to the smart grid. Through its leading edge offering GridOS™, Opus One delivers a new level of visibility and control to electricity distribution through sophisticated engineering analytics designed to solve and optimize complex power flows. Seamlessly integrating with utility data systems, GridOS™ provides powerful grid management capabilities and unlocks greater potential for distributed energy resources including renewable generation, energy storage and responsive demand. GridOS™ further facilitates the implementation and management of microgrids from homes to communities for unparalleled grid resiliency and value to the electricity customer. https://www.opusonesolutions.com/
